    Build delete intems ?

    This question is for all those who have built/are building and have a real good understanding of what is/is not needed BASED on your build.

    I like others here plan on a lot of new/aftermarket solutions from the vendors, upgrades from old parts with great looks !.

    My donor was an 04 RS, I purchased an ej207/trans for the power. After tear down, many parts are just not what I want to use ( ie the front LCAs - replacing with the 06 aluminum )
    The electrical was a mess, also the RS was an 2.5NA auto car, so I am going Painless and a MegaSquirt.

    Here is what I think will be unused parts in the kit while looking at the packaging list.
    80318 - Steering rack mount - (going vendor)
    80238 - Push Pull cable - (MR2 - set up with bell crank)
    26185 - Shifter
    80312 - Hood pin set - (want an actual pull hood release, like our 85 RX7 type)
    80007 - Stop tail lights - (like other aftermarkets better)
    BOX 5 - lines and Coolant tubes - (going vendor)
    Fuel tank - (boyds or other front mount)
    80279 - Fuel sending unit ? - (why did I save the unit from the Scooby if one is included)

    Again, What was in the kit that you either didn't use, or replace with something better ?
    I'd hate to have a box full of stuff I am not going to need,use,or upgrade.

    Thank you for the input, Be safe.

    It's a new tank from factory five that uses the two donor sender's mine seems to work fine. I didn't use supplied mirror brackets used aftermarket mirrors, I replacing the aluminium trim rings for the mesh with edge guard.i didn't use intercooler aluminium ducts (went side mount ic). Non FF5 upgrades replaced brakes with 4/2 pots, STI pan baffle and dipstick, megasquirt 3X for management and built my own harness, smic, outfront motorsports fuel rails 800cc injectors 16g turbo, intercooler sprayer, jbperformance dual VR conditioner boards for avcs and traction control. Biggest fix before you go too far is seat belt anchor points figure them out before cockpit aluminium is installed if possible.

    Besides the items you mention, I didn't use any of the center console aluminum but that depends on what you are doing. Have you seen what Andrew (Aero STI) did with his interior? Also a few others going in that direction.
    You might want to consider deleting the lights. Many are going for the projector or LED halo's or other upgrades available on the market.
